PCB is vertical without blown air. 2C is a fixed capacitance that gives the same stored energy as C while V is rising from 0 to 80% V o(er) oss DS DSS. 3C o(tr) is a fixed capacitance that gives the same charging time as Coss while V DS is rising from 0 to 80% V DSS.
